Why we need you

  • We are looking for a Sr. Staff Systems Engineer focused on Vehicle Management Systems to join our team. The goal of a Vehicle Management System is to host and integrate the most critical functions supporting system automation, motion control and health status of the vehicle during all the phases of the mission. We work with a team of systems engineers and integrators to deliver a product complaint to a reliable and safe operation.
  • You will lead functional, logical and physical architecture design and integration, by supporting the full product life cycle, from concept to detailed design, integration and verification. You will contribute to requirement and design documents, support trades and manage interfaces, among other System Engineering deliverables.
  • The successful candidate has proven experience with fly-by-wire flight controls or other safety critical control systems full life cycle development. The candidate should be proactive, self-motivated, able to work in ambiguous situations, and have good prioritization skills.

What you will do

  • You will contribute and guide a high performing Systems Engineering team to develop functions, architecture, requirements, integrate between system interfaces, and develop process strategy, responsible for delivering high quality Systems Engineering artifacts for a novel type of aircraft development targeting the autonomous UAM market.
  • You will review safety critical system integration activities based on today's best system engineering practices, lessons learned and guidelines.
  • You will lead multiple trade studies needed to achieve the most efficient and optimized safety critical systems architectural solutions that meet performance, size, weight, power and safety requirements as applicable from the FAA/EASA regulations.
  • You will lead the system requirements development and validation efforts for the Vehicle Management System IPT.
  • You will exemplify the culture, mission, values, vision and quality policy of the organization, while supporting the team with technical guidance and mentorship.

What you have done

  • Hands on experience in development and decomposition of requirements, developing and allocating functions, and interfacing with certification and systems safety teams to deliver certification deliverables.
  • B.S. in engineering and 8 years experience in control systems development
  • Experience in requirements management tools such as Polarion, Doors, Requiem etc.
  • Familiarity with DO-160, DO-178, DO-254
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ills
  • Experience with ARP4754, ARP4761

Desired

  • Familiarity with MBSE methodology and tools (SysML, Cameo or other).
  • Familiarity with regulatory requirements such as Part 23/25, Part 33, and Part 35
  • Experience with an aircraft or UAM development program
